(Docs. 2, 10, 13) 16 17 Plaintiff Hector Clarence Anderson is a state prisoner proceeding pro se in this civil rights 18 action under 42 U.S.C. § 1983. On July 31, 2019, and August 14, 2019, Plaintiff filed motions to 19 proceed in forma pauperis. (Docs. 2, 10.) This matter was referred to a United States magistrate 20 judge pursuant to 28 U.S.C. § 636(b)(1)(B) and Local Rule 302. 21 On September 5, 2019, the magistrate judge issued findings and recommendations to deny 22 Plaintiff’s motions to proceed in forma pauperis because he has three “strikes” under 28 U.S.C. 23 § 1915(g) and fails to show that he is in imminent danger of serious physical injury. (Doc. 13.) 24 Upon Plaintiff’s motion, (Doc. 14), the magistrate judge granted Plaintiff an extension of time to 25 file objections to the findings and recommendations. (Doc. 15.) Though the extended deadline has 26 passed, Plaintiff has not filed any objections. 27 28 In accordance with the provisions of 28 U.S.C. § 636(b)(1)(C), this Court has conducted a de novo review of this case. Having carefully reviewed the file, the Court finds the findings and 1 recommendations to be supported by the record and proper analysis. 2 Accordingly, the Court HEREBY ORDERS that: 3 1. 4 5 ADOPTED in full; 2. 6 7 The findings and recommendations issued on September 5, 2019, (Doc. 13), be Plaintiff’s applications to proceed in forma pauperis, (Docs. 2, 10), be DENIED; and, 3. 8 This action be DISMISSED without prejudice to refiling upon prepayment of the filing fee. 9 10 11 IT IS SO ORDERED.
